Although spring is quickly approaching, there is still much work to do before her arrival. In the winter months, the priority is to tend to the commercial crop from last harvest, which has been dried, wrapped in brown unbleached paper, put into bins and bucked. Now that it’s off to the processor for trimming and packaging, and eventually distributed into stores across California, we can begin to trim our personal stash. This traditionally happens at the end of a busy workday, when we settle down and listen to audio books while manicuring our own buds, a mellow close to the day….

Man Surrenders To Darien Police On DUI Charge – Daily Voice
A 27-year-old Fairfield County man who had been wanted for years turned himself in to police custody and is facing a host of charges for an alleged DUI. Shortly after 12:30 a.m. on June 1, 2017, Darien police officers arrested Norwalk resident Jorge Canola for alleged impaired driving after he was stopped making an illegal turn onto Old Kings Highway South. At the time of the traffic stop, police said that Canola did not have a valid driver’s license, had been busted repeatedly for driving with a suspended license, he had alcohol on his breath, and bloodshot eyes. Bridgeport police: Woman faces charges after drugs found in her car – News 12 Connecticut
Mar 12, 2022, 12:36pmUpdated 13h ago By: News 12 Staff Police say a woman from Bristol is facing drug charges in Bridgeport. Bridgeport police say they were patrolling on the west side of the city when Lori-Lee Benson didn’t stop for a stop sign. Officers say when they pulled her over they found marijuana, ecstasy, cocaine and other drugs, along with $400 in cash. Benson was arrested and faces several charges.
